Allaying fears that Anna University would come under the Centre once bifurcated, principal secretary to Higher Education Department Mangat Ram Sharma on Wednesday said the university would remain a state university.

Replying to a question on the issue, Sharma said an impression has been created that the state would lose control over the university once it was bifurcated.

However, the varsity would remain a state university, he said.

Asked about the decision on bifurcation, Sharma said a group of five ministers has already been formed, and it has met once to discuss the pros and cons.

The group would again meet in a few days and after two or three such meetings a final decision would be taken, he added.

The Tamil Nadu government had plans to split the Anna university to take up more research activities related to higher education.
